Transponder Keys
A lot of cars built after the '90s have transponder chips in the key to stop thieves from hot wiring your vehicle. If you lose your key with a chip, you need to replace it as soon as possible since the car won't be able to start if it isn't.
It's simple to do when you have an extra key. You can bring it to an automotive locksmith to get them to clone your key at a cheaper rate than what a dealer would cost. If you're looking to save some money and time, you can do it yourself. However it is more complex and requires some expertise to perform it correctly.
The key can serve as a replacement for the ignition, however it will not be able to start the engine. It cannot replace the ignition, as you require the transponder in order to transmit a signal to the immobilizer system in your car to start the motor.
The chip inside the key transmits a radio frequency signal to the immobilizer once it is placed in the ignition cylinder. The immobilizer makes sure whether the chip's code matches the code it needs to start the vehicle. If the key and chip are not compatible then the engine will not turn over.
Professionals can program keys for your vehicle using an electronic signal to the chip on the key that corresponds to the code on the immobilizer. The technician can then erase the old key from the vehicle's system, so that it will only accept the new key as a working and valid device.
There is the option of having a transponder chip embedded into your key in the blade design that must be placed into the ignition cylinder or the integrated version that is on the fob. The cost of transponder keys will be more expensive than a regular key. However the added security and convenience the chip offers is worth the extra cost.
